Job description

Description


Zafran is looking for a Senior DevOps Engineer with a strong security and compliance background to lead our compliance posture and prepare us for FedRAMP. You will work on hardening our infrastructure, implementing the controls required for regulated customers, and building the evidence and automation needed to achieve and maintain compliance certifications. This role partners closely with our Security team and Tel Aviv DevOps team.

What you will do

  • Lead the technical work to achieve and maintain compliance certifications (SOC 2, ISO 27001, and the upcoming FedRAMP process)
  • Design and implement security controls across AWS infrastructure, CI/CD pipelines, Kubernetes, and application deployments
  • Build the automation, logging, and evidence collection required for continuous compliance
  • Implement and maintain secrets management, IAM hardening, network segmentation, and encryption standards
  • Develop infrastructure solutions for customers in highly regulated industries, including isolated or dedicated environments
  • Collaborate with security, legal, and engineering on threat modeling, vulnerability management, and incident response
  • Stay ahead of FedRAMP, FISMA, and related federal requirements and translate them into concrete engineering work



Requirements


  • Must be located in the US, with a strong preference for the New York area; US remote considered
  • U.S. citizenship or lawful permanent resident status (Green Card) required due to FedRAMP-related eligibility requirements and access to a U.S.-only environment.
  • 5+ years of DevOps / platform engineering experience with a strong security focus
  • Direct experience implementing controls for SOC 2, ISO 27001, HIPAA, PCI, or FedRAMP
  • Deep AWS security knowledge: IAM, KMS, GuardDuty, Security Hub, VPC design, Config
  • Strong Kubernetes security experience: network policies, admission control, runtime security
  • Infrastructure as Code with Terraform, with a focus on policy-as-code 
  • CI/CD security: SAST, DAST, SCA, image scanning, supply chain hardening
  • Solid scripting in Python or Bash
